Song Meaning
The lyrics present a stark, almost hypnotic repetition of the phrase "In and out." This simple, cyclical structure immediately establishes a sense of relentless motion or a recurring state. The vocalizations "Do-do-do" further enhance this feeling, adding a layer of almost childlike, yet insistent, rhythm that underscores the primary phrase.
This constant return to "in and out" suggests a fundamental tension or a back-and-forth dynamic. It could imply a physical action, a mental state of indecision, or a pattern of behavior that is difficult to break. The lack of any narrative or descriptive content forces the listener to project their own meaning onto this core idea, making the repetition itself the central emotional driver.
The most striking aspect of the craft here is the extreme minimalism. By stripping away all other lyrical elements, the focus is entirely on the sonic and conceptual weight of "in and out." This deliberate sparseness creates a powerful, almost meditative effect, drawing attention to the inherent ambiguity and potential frustration or comfort within such a repetitive cycle.
Ultimately, the effectiveness of these lyrics lies in their ability to create a potent atmosphere through sheer repetition. The listener is left with a feeling of being caught in a loop, a state that can be interpreted as either a source of anxiety or a strange form of grounding, depending on their own perspective.
